Find the volume of this square
based pyramid.
10 cm
8 cm
8 cm
V = [?] cm3

Answer:

213.3

Step-by-step explanation:

The volume of a pyramid is 1/3 base times height.

Using this formula, our square base is 8*8, or 64 square units.

Multiplying that by the height, 10. We get 64*10, 640.

Finally dividing by 3, we have 213.3333333333...

Rounding that to the nearest tenth, 213.3.
